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at(example): Superset Community Dashboard #28155

Open
wants to merge 6 commits into
base: master
Choose a base branch
from

Conversation

rusackas
Copy link
Member

@rusackas rusackas commented Apr 19, 2024

SUMMARY

Adds a live dashboard, using Shellelagh to pull data from a Google sheet (generated by GitHub actions) and the GitHub API (also via Shellelagh)

TODO:
Add licenses
Warn when loading examples that you'll hit external sources (Google, GitHub) - this will make ASF happy

BEFORE/AFTER SCREENSHOTS OR ANIMATED GIF

TESTING INSTRUCTIONS

I'll spin up an ephemeral and see if it works!

ADDITIONAL INFORMATION

  • Has associated issue:
  • Required feature flags:
  • Changes UI
  • Includes DB Migration (follow approval process in SIP-59)
    • Migration is atomic, supports rollback & is backwards-compatible
    • Confirm DB migration upgrade and downgrade tested
    • Runtime estimates and downtime expectations provided
  • Introduces new feature or API
  • Removes existing feature or API

@rusackas
Copy link
Member Author

/testenv up

Copy link
Contributor

@rusackas Ephemeral environment spinning up at http://34.222.50.188:8080. Credentials are admin/admin. Please allow several minutes for bootstrapping and startup.

@rusackas
Copy link
Member Author

/testenv down

@rusackas rusackas closed this Apr 20, 2024
@rusackas rusackas reopened this Apr 20, 2024
Copy link
Contributor

Ephemeral environment shutdown and build artifacts deleted.

@rusackas
Copy link
Member Author

/testenv up

Copy link
Contributor

@rusackas Ephemeral environment spinning up at http://52.27.230.250:8080. Credentials are admin/admin. Please allow several minutes for bootstrapping and startup.

@rusackas rusackas closed this Apr 20, 2024
Copy link
Contributor

Ephemeral environment shutdown and build artifacts deleted.

@rusackas rusackas reopened this Apr 20, 2024
@rusackas
Copy link
Member Author

/testenv up

Copy link
Contributor

@rusackas Ephemeral environment spinning up at http://54.202.150.243:8080. Credentials are admin/admin. Please allow several minutes for bootstrapping and startup.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

1 participant